Help please with the following clues. Any help greatly appreciated
4d Acid drops( 6 5) ?i???? ?e?r?
10a Took to crime and it wasn't successful..... (4 5) ?e?? ?????
12a ....... but forced to give up one's wicked ways.was a success (4 4)
5d He's gone off to call on, making the distribution (7) ?h?????
TIA